Anti-Inflammatory Power Salad

‘Anti-Inflammatory Power Salad’ a hearty lunch option with an abundance of known anti-inflammatory ingredients including barley, red onion, parsnips, walnuts, goji berries, kale and turmeric.
This salad is delicious served hot or cold and can be easily doubled or tripled for weekly meal prep.

Ingredients
 ⅓ cup pearl barley
 
2 large parsnips, peeled and chopped into rough chunks
½ medium red onion, peeled and chopped into rough chunks
½ tbsp olive oil
Salt & pepper to taste
 
A large handful of kale, roughly chopped
A small handful of walnuts, roughly chopped
1 tbsp goji berries

Dressing:
Juice of ½ lemon
½ tbsp maple syrup
1 tsp mustard
½ tsp ground turmeric
Salt & pepper to taste
Picture
Method
Preheat the oven to 170°C fan and line a tray with baking paper.
 
In a small saucepan add barley along with ⅔ cup of water.
Bring to the boil, reduce heat to simmer and cover.
Allow barley to cook until liquid is fully absorbed.
 
Evenly spread parsnips and onion over the tray.
Drizzle with oil and season with salt & pepper.
Bake for 30mins.
 
Meanwhile prepare dressing by combining all ingredients in a small bowl or jar.
 
Add chopped kale to a bowl, pour over dressing and massage until slightly wilted.
 
Once barely and veggies are cooked add to the bowl.
(If enjoying salad cold, allow barely and veggies to cool before incorporating.)
 
Sprinkle in walnuts and goji berries before giving a good toss.
 
Serves 1
